Acts 15:31-32
New American Standard Bible
Chapter 15
31
When they had read it, they rejoiced because of its encouragement.
32
Judas and Silas, also being prophets themselves, encouraged and strengthened the brothers
and sisters
with a lengthy message.
King James Version
Chapter 15
31
Which
when they had read, they rejoiced for the consolation.
32
And Judas and Silas, being prophets also themselves, exhorted the brethren with many words, and confirmed
them
.
Christian Standard Bible
Chapter 15
31
When they read it, they rejoiced because of its encouragement.
32
Both Judas and Silas, who were also prophets themselves, encouraged the brothers and sisters and strengthened them with a long message.
New Living Translation
Chapter 15
31
And there was great joy throughout the church that day as they read this encouraging message.
32
Then Judas and Silas, both being prophets, spoke at length to the believers, encouraging and strengthening their faith.
English Standard Version
Chapter 15
31
And when they had read it, they rejoiced because of its encouragement.
32
And Judas and Silas, who were themselves prophets, encouraged and strengthened the brothers with many words.
New International Version
Chapter 15
31
The people read it and were glad for its encouraging message.
32
Judas and Silas, who themselves were prophets, said much to encourage and strengthen the believers.
New King James Version
Chapter 15
31
When they had read it, they rejoiced over its encouragement.
32
Now Judas and Silas, themselves being prophets also, exhorted and strengthened the brethren with many words.
